// Client setup: Glyphhaven font vendoring service
//
// New folks: we don't pull third-party fonts at build time anymore.
// All licensed typefaces are vendored through the internal Glyphhaven
// mirror, which checks license terms and pins exact file hashes.
// This client fetches the vendored bundle during CI only — never at
// runtime. Don't point it at upstream foundries directly; that breaks
// our license audit.
//
// Authenticate the client with the key below.

API key for yahig-tadup: kto7_ubizbYm

## Formula sandbox tuning

User-supplied formulas in Gridmoor execute inside a restricted interpreter with hard ceilings on time, memory, and call depth. Reviewers should confirm any change to these ceilings is justified in the PR description, since raising them widens the abuse surface. Defaults were chosen from production traces. The current limits are as follows.

limits module of tafog-fawip:
WEIGHTS = {
    "julix": 57,
    "lamys": 992,
    "kasvan": 209,
    "quenok": 750,
    "alddor": 259,
    "oliath": 1009,
    "wenix": 815,
}

[ ] Key ceremony step 7 — Quarantine flaky integration tests. The Pennythistle payments service has three intermittently failing tests in the settlement suite; confirm they are tagged and excluded from the ceremony verification run so a spurious red build cannot block key rotation. The security reviewer should countersign the exclusion list and verify the ceremony HSM partition is reachable. If the partition requires re-authentication after the test run, unseal it using the recovery passphrase recorded below.

strongbox words: fraath-isteth

Subject: Sweeper cut-over complete

Team — the cut-over of the orphaned-resource sweeper to the new Tidewrack cluster finished last night. Old sweeper is disabled, not deleted; we'll remove it after two clean weeks. Behavior change to note: the new sweeper flags resources for 48 hours before deletion instead of deleting immediately, so expect fewer panicked escalations. Dry-run mode is off as of 06:00. For support triage, these are the active configuration values.

service settings:
WENATH_PIN=5007
WENATH_METRICS_HOST=metrics.wenath.tolvaqlabs.corp
WENATH_LOG_LEVEL=debug
WENATH_TENANT=rusox